Chimney inspection services involve a thorough examination of a chimney’s internal and external components to assess their condition and identify potential issues. Professionals utilize specialized tools and techniques to inspect the flue liner, chimney structure, and venting system. This process helps detect problems such as creosote buildup, cracks, blockages, or deterioration that could compromise the chimney’s safety and efficiency. Regular inspections are recommended to ensure that the chimney operates properly and to prevent potential hazards associated with malfunctioning systems.
These services are essential for addressing common chimney-related problems that can affect property safety and performance. For instance, creosote accumulation can increase the risk of chimney fires, while cracks or structural damage may lead to leaks or improper venting of smoke and gases. Inspections also help identify obstructions like bird nests or debris that could impede proper airflow. Detecting these issues early allows property owners to schedule necessary repairs or maintenance, reducing the likelihood of costly damage or safety incidents.
Chimney inspection services are applicable to a variety of properties, including residential homes, multi-family dwellings, and commercial buildings equipped with fireplaces or heating systems that vent through chimneys. Older properties with aging chimneys often require more frequent inspections to ensure continued safe operation. Additionally, properties that have experienced recent weather events, chimney damage, or renovations may benefit from an inspection to verify that the chimney remains in good condition and compliant with safety standards.

Inspection Costs - The typical cost for a chimney inspection ranges from $100 to $300, depending on the home's size and the inspection's complexity. For example, a standard inspection in Calabasas might be around $150. Prices can vary based on local service providers and specific service needs.
Chimney Sweeping Fees - Professional chimney sweeping services usually cost between $120 and $250. A basic sweep in the Calabasas area might be around $180, with prices influenced by chimney size and accessibility.
Repair Estimates - Repair costs for chimney issues can range from $200 to over $1,000, depending on the extent of damage. Minor repairs, such as mortar patching, might be around $250, while extensive repairs could be significantly higher.
Consultation Expenses - Some service providers charge between $50 and $150 for a consultation or detailed assessment. This fee may be credited toward repair or inspection services if booked through the same provider in Calabasas.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is involved in a chimney inspection? A chimney inspection typically includes examining the chimney structure, flue, and components to assess their condition and identify any potential issues.
Why should I schedule regular chimney inspections? Regular inspections help ensure the safety, efficiency, and proper functioning of the chimney, potentially preventing costly repairs or hazards.
How often should a chimney be inspected? It is generally recommended to have a chimney inspected at least once a year or after any significant use or weather event.
What signs indicate I need a chimney inspection? Signs such as smoke backup, unpleasant odors, or visible damage to the chimney structure suggest an inspection may be needed.
